export function createAsar(folderPath: string, unpackGlobs: string[], destFilename: string): NodeJS.ReadWriteStream { | ||
|
||
const shouldUnpackFile = (file: VinylFile): boolean => { | ||
for (let i = 0; i < unpackGlobs.length; i++) { | ||
if (minimatch(file.relative, unpackGlobs[i])) { | ||
return true; | ||
} | ||
} | ||
return false; | ||
}; | ||
|
||
const filesystem = new Filesystem(folderPath); | ||
const out: Buffer[] = []; | ||
|
||
// Keep track of pending inserts | ||
let pendingInserts = 0; | ||
let onFileInserted = () => { pendingInserts--; }; | ||
|
||
// Do not insert twice the same directory | ||
const seenDir: { [key: string]: boolean; } = {}; | ||
const insertDirectoryRecursive = (dir: string) => { | ||
if (seenDir[dir]) { | ||
return; | ||
} | ||
|
||
const lastSlash = dir.lastIndexOf('/'); | ||
if (lastSlash !== -1) { | ||
insertDirectoryRecursive(dir.substring(0, lastSlash)); | ||
} | ||
seenDir[dir] = true; | ||
filesystem.insertDirectory(dir); | ||
}; | ||
|
||
const insertDirectoryForFile = (file: string) => { | ||
const lastSlash = file.lastIndexOf('/'); | ||
if (lastSlash !== -1) { | ||
insertDirectoryRecursive(file.substring(0, lastSlash)); | ||
} | ||
}; | ||
|
||
const insertFile = (relativePath: string, stat: { size: number; mode: number; }, shouldUnpack: boolean) => { | ||
insertDirectoryForFile(relativePath); | ||
pendingInserts++; | ||
filesystem.insertFile(relativePath, shouldUnpack, { stat: stat }, {}, onFileInserted); | ||
}; | ||
|
||
return es.through(function (file) { | ||
if (file.stat.isDirectory()) { | ||
return; | ||
} | ||
if (!file.stat.isFile()) { | ||
throw new Error(`unknown item in stream!`); | ||
} | ||
const shouldUnpack = shouldUnpackFile(file); | ||
insertFile(file.relative, { size: file.contents.length, mode: file.stat.mode }, shouldUnpack); | ||
|
||
if (shouldUnpack) { | ||
// The file goes outside of xx.asar, in a folder xx.asar.unpacked | ||
const relative = path.relative(folderPath, file.path); | ||
this.queue(new VinylFile({ | ||
cwd: folderPath, | ||
base: folderPath, | ||
path: path.join(destFilename + '.unpacked', relative), | ||
contents: file.contents | ||
})); | ||
} else { | ||
// The file goes inside of xx.asar | ||
out.push(file.contents); | ||
} | ||
}, function () { | ||
|
||
let finish = () => { | ||
{ | ||
const headerPickle = pickle.createEmpty(); | ||
headerPickle.writeString(JSON.stringify(filesystem.header)); | ||
const headerBuf = headerPickle.toBuffer(); | ||
|
||
const sizePickle = pickle.createEmpty(); | ||
sizePickle.writeUInt32(headerBuf.length); | ||
const sizeBuf = sizePickle.toBuffer(); | ||
|
||
out.unshift(headerBuf); | ||
out.unshift(sizeBuf); | ||
} | ||
|
||
this.queue(new VinylFile({ | ||
cwd: folderPath, | ||
base: folderPath, | ||
path: destFilename, | ||
contents: Buffer.concat(out) | ||
})); | ||
this.queue(null); | ||
}; | ||
|
||
// Call finish() only when all file inserts have finished... | ||
if (pendingInserts === 0) { | ||
finish(); | ||
} else { | ||
onFileInserted = () => { | ||
pendingInserts--; | ||
if (pendingInserts === 0) { | ||
finish(); | ||
} | ||
}; | ||
} | ||
}); | ||
} |
